$choices-border-radius:			$input-border-radius;
$choices-border-radius-item:	0;
$choices-bg-color:				transparent;
$choices-primary-color:			$primary;
$choices-font-size-md:			.75rem;

@import "~choices.js/src/styles/choices";

.#{$choices-selector}.is-focused .choices__inner {
	border-color: #c4e595;
	box-shadow: 0 0 0 0.2rem rgba(139, 200, 50, 0.25);

	body.company & {
		border-color: #88badf;
		box-shadow: 0 0 0 0.2rem rgba(38, 138, 209, 0.2);
	}
}

.#{$choices-selector}__inner {
	min-height: 3rem;
	padding: .6875rem 2rem .25rem .5rem;

	.choices__list {
		.choices__item {
			font-size: 16px;
			font-weight: 300;
		}

		&:empty {
			width: calc(24px - 0.5rem);
			display: inline-block;
		}
	}

	.choices__input {
		font-size: 16px;
		font-weight: 300;
		width: 85px !important;
	}
}


.#{$choices-selector}__list--dropdown {
	z-index: 2;

	.#{$choices-selector}__item {
		font-weight: 300;
	}
}
